Efficient Vinyl Windows
Due to their affordability and accessibility, vinyl windows remain one of the most popular options not only in Houston, but across the country as well. In addition to being cost-effective, vinyl windows are extremely energy-efficient and will do an excellent job keeping all that hot Texas sunshine out of your home. This means that homeowners investing in vinyl windows may be able to look forward to reduced energy bills every month, even when temperatures start nearing 100 degrees.
Some other advantages to having vinyl windows installed include:
- No Painting or Staining Required
- Resistant to Pests and Insects
- Wide Variety of Colors and Styles
Rustic Wood Windows
Once the standard for all homes, wood windows still offer a timeless, classic aesthetic to any residence. Wood is easily customizable, allowing consumers to envision just about any shape or dimension for the new windows on their home when using this environmentally-friendly material. Because of their unmatched beauty, wood windows can also contribute to an increased home value!
However, the high amount of moisture and rainfall in Houston can make it hard to maintain healthy wood windows. If you prefer the rustic charm that this option provides, it's important to seal your wood windows with a reliable caulking option, like silicone or polyurethane, and to apply a protective finish over the top.
Durable Aluminum Windows
When heavy rains, hail, high winds or hurricanes hit Houston, aluminum windows do an excellent job enduring the various elements. Their strength prevents warping or cracking under high pressure, and resists rust, corrosion, or other common window issues in humid climates.
Some other benefits of aluminum windows include:
- Long Lifespans
- Low Maintenance
- Eco-Friendly
- Lightweight
